Abstract

The present invention provides a multifunctional detection device, comprising: the sensor detection circuit is used for detecting the working state of the sensor; the input module detection circuit is connected with the sensor detection circuit and is used for detecting the working state of the input port of the equipment to be detected; and the power supply circuit is connected with the sensor detection circuit and the input module detection circuit and used for providing power for the sensor detection circuit and the input module detection circuit to work, wherein the input module detection circuit comprises a digital quantity detection circuit and an analog quantity detection circuit. The multifunctional detection device can detect the working state of the sensor, can detect the working state of the input port of the equipment to be detected through the output signal, can match different input ports by using digital quantity and analog quantity, can enable maintenance personnel with different levels to obtain the same detection result, shortens the time of fault judgment in production and maintenance, and reduces the outage rate of the equipment.

Technical Field
The utility model relates to the technical field of detection, in particular to a multifunctional detection device.
Background
The on-site judgment of the working condition of the sensor and the equipment input port generally requires a universal meter for measurement, is time-consuming, and has the defects that the measurement result is different according to the level of personnel, thereby influencing the accuracy of the judgment result.
There is a need for a detection device that can be adapted to maintenance personnel at each level and that can quickly and accurately derive a detection result.

Referring to fig. 1, in order to quickly determine the status of the field sensor and the quality of the input module, the present invention provides a multifunctional detection device, which includes: sensor detection circuitry 1, input module detection circuitry 2, wherein, sensor detection circuitry 1 is used for detecting the operating condition of sensor, input module detection circuitry 2 connects sensor detection circuitry for detect the operating condition of equipment under test input port.
Specifically, the sensor detection circuit 1 includes: a first relay J1, a second switch K2, a first resistor R1, a second resistor R2 and a third resistor R3, and a first indicator lamp D1, a second indicator lamp D2 and a third indicator lamp D3, wherein a first interface of the first relay J1 is connected with the positive electrode of the direct-current power supply V through the second switch K2; a second interface of the first relay J1 is sequentially connected with the third resistor R3 and the third indicator light D3, and the tail end of the second relay is connected with the negative electrode of the direct-current power supply V; a third interface of the first relay J1 is connected with the negative electrode of the direct-current power supply V; the fourth interface of the first relay J1 is sequentially connected to the second resistor R2 and the second indicator light D2, and the tail end of the fourth interface is connected to the negative electrode of the dc power supply V.
In an embodiment, as shown in fig. 2, the multifunctional detecting device further includes a power supply circuit 3, connected to the sensor detecting circuit 1 and the input module detecting circuit 2, for providing power to the sensor detecting circuit 1 and the input module detecting circuit 2 to operate, where the power supply circuit 3 includes a dc power source V and a first switch K1 connected in series therewith.
In one embodiment, as shown in fig. 2, the input module detecting circuit 2 includes a digital quantity detecting circuit 21 and an analog quantity detecting circuit 22, wherein the digital quantity detecting circuit 21 includes a second relay J2, a fourth resistor R4, a fourth indicator light D4, a fifth switch K5 and a sixth switch K6; the analog quantity detection circuit comprises a third relay J3, a third switch K3, a fourth switch K4, a fifth resistor R5, a fifth indicator light D5, a first variable resistor RP1, a second variable resistor RP2, a first voltmeter V1 and a second voltmeter V2.
Further, in one embodiment, as shown in fig. 2, the precast cable of the sensor is connected to the first relay J1, the second switch K2 is opened, and if the power supply is normal, the first indicator light D1 is lighted; when the sensor detects that there is an output from an object, the second indicator light D2 or the third indicator light D3 is turned on to determine whether the sensor is good or bad. Preferably, the first indicator light D1, the second indicator light D2 and the third indicator light D3 are light emitting diodes, respectively.
In an embodiment, further, the first interface of the second relay J2 is respectively connected to one end of the fourth resistor R4, one end of the fifth switch K5, and one end of the sixth switch K6; the other end of the fourth resistor R4 is connected with one end of the fourth indicator light D4; a second interface of the second relay J2 is connected with the other end of the fifth switch K5; a third interface of the second relay J2 is respectively connected with the other end of the fourth indicator light D4 and the negative electrode of the direct-current power supply V; the fourth interface of the second relay J2 is connected to the other end of the sixth switch K6.
Specifically, a second precast cable is inserted into the product input port through a second relay J2, if the power supply of the direct current power supply is normal, the fourth indicator light D4 is turned on, the third switch K3 and the fourth switch K4 are pressed to output a digital signal to the product input port in an analog manner, if the point lamp corresponding to the product is turned on, it is determined that the digital input is normal, and otherwise, it is abnormal.
In an embodiment, further, the third interface of the third relay J3 is connected to the negative electrode of the dc power source V; a first interface of the third relay J3 is connected to a fixed end of a fifth resistor R5 and a fixed end of a first variable resistor RP1 through a third switch K3, one end of the fifth resistor R5, which is far away from the third switch K3, is connected to a fifth indicator light D5, and one end of the fifth indicator light D5, which is far away from the fifth resistor R5, is connected to a negative electrode of the dc power supply V; a fixed end of the first variable resistor RP1 far away from the third switch K3 is connected with the cathode of the direct current power supply V, and a sliding end of the first variable resistor RP1 is connected with a fixed end of the second variable resistor RP 2; a fixed end of the second variable resistor RP2 far away from the first resistor RP1 is connected with the negative electrode of the direct current power supply V, and a sliding end of the second variable resistor RP2 is connected with the movable contact of the fourth switch K4; the first fixed contact of the fourth switch K4 is connected to the second port of the third relay J3, and the second fixed contact of the fourth switch K4 is connected to the fourth port of the third relay J3.
Further, a first voltmeter V1 is connected between the sliding end of the first variable resistor RP1 and the negative electrode of the direct-current power supply V; and a second voltmeter V2 is connected between the sliding end of the second variable resistor RP2 and the negative electrode of the direct-current power supply V.
Specifically, a third precast cable is inserted into the product input port through a third relay J2, a fifth switch K5 is turned on, if the power supply of the direct current power supply is normal, the fifth indicator light D5 is turned on, the first variable resistor RP1 is adjusted to keep the value of the first voltmeter V1 at 10 volts, the second variable resistor RP2 is adjusted, the second voltmeter V2 is compared with the read voltage of the product to determine whether the analog input is normal, if the analog input is the same, the analog input is normal, and if the analog input is the same, the analog input is abnormal.
